Chang Khati is a village situated in Golaghat circle of Golaghat district in Assam.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 139 families residing in the village Chang Khati. The total population of Chang Khati is 677 out of which 318 are males and 359 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Chang Khati is 1,129.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Chang Khati village is 90 which is 13% of the total population. There are 40 male children and 50 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Chang Khati is 1,250 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(1,129) of Chang Khati village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Chang Khati is 72.2%. Thus Chang Khati village has a higher literacy rate compared to 67.7% of Golaghat district. The male literacy rate is 79.86% and the female literacy rate is 65.37% in Chang Khati village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 54.8% of total population in Chang Khati village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Chang Khati village out of total population, 379 were engaged in work activities. 63.3%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 36.7%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 379 workers engaged in Main Work, 181 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 8 were Agricultural labourers.
